Nvidia has formed alliances with Peak XV Partners and Accel India to identify and support promising AI startups. These collaborations aim to provide capital, strategic guidance and access to Nvidia’s ecosystem for ventures building next-generation AI solutions. The company extended its Inception accelerator network in India to more than 4,000 startups. Participants gain access to development resources, co-marketing opportunities and early access to Nvidia technologies to help scale their AI applications. Select research institutions will receive complimentary Nvidia AI Enterprise software licenses and access to technical mentorship through Nvidia’s AI Technology Center. The initiative includes hands-on training via bootcamps and hackathons to accelerate AI research in science and engineering disciplines. Nvidia is collaborating with the IndiaAI Mission, a $1 billion national drive to enhance the country’s AI infrastructure. The program focuses on expanding high-performance computing capacity, creating sovereign data sets and developing frontier AI models to support research and industry needs.
